updated list:
The Big Melee Events (100+ attendees)
-2004: 2 | TG6, GO
-2005: 6 | FC3, GS2, MLG DC, MLG SF, BOMB 4, MOAST 3
-2006: 10 | MLG New York Opener, MLG Dallas, MLG Anaheim, MLG Chicago, MLG Orlando, MLG New York Playoffs (200+!), FC6 (200+!), OC2, SMYM 6, Gauntlet
-2007: 13 | OC3 (200+!), FC-Diamond (200+!), Cataclysm, EVO South, EVO West, EVO World (200+!), Smash Royale III, Renaissance of Smash 4, Innsomnia, Pound 2 (200+!), SCC (200+!), VLS, UCLA IV
-2008: 5 | Pound 3 (200+!), UCLA V, TGMTSBCO, ESA 2 (200+!), Event 52
-2009: 9 | SMYM 9, Revival of Melee, Mango Juice, ESA 3, Genesis (200+!), SMYM 10, TSL 4, Pat's House, RoM 2
-2010: 6 | Pound 4 (300+!), SMYM 11, APEX 2010 (200+!), SNY 1, RoM 3, DGDTJ
-2011: 8 | Pound V (200+!), Wintergamesfest 2011, SMYM 12, B.E.A.S.T 1, Genesis 2 (200+!), B.E.A.S.T 2, The Big House, RoM4
